The standout feature of the v3.10.0 update is the latest version of Lossless Scaling Frame Generation (LSFG). Unlike AMD FSR 3 or NVIDIA DLSS 3, which require specific game integration and modern graphics cards, LSFG works universally. | Problem | Solution | |---------|----------| | "Failed to start scaling" | Run the game in mode (not fullscreen exclusive). | | Black screen after scaling | Disable HDR in game and Windows. | | High input lag | Set Max Frame Latency = 1 and Sync Mode = Off . | | Portable settings not saving | Check if config.ini is read-only or folder is write-protected (e.g., on USB drive). | | Hotkey not working | Portable version may require admin rights for global hotkeys. Try running as admin. | | Frame gen artifacts (warping UI) | Enable "Draw FPS" and check if base FPS is stable; lower Resolution Scale to 75%. |

Lock your game's frame rate to exactly half of your screen's refresh rate (e.g., lock to 30 FPS for a 60Hz experience, or 45 FPS for a 90Hz experience). Step 2: Configure Lossless Scaling Open the executable file. Set Scaling Type to LS1 or AMD FSR . Under the Frame Generation menu, select LSFG .
Many retro games rely on pixel art. Traditional scaling destroys the intended blocky aesthetic. The V3100 includes a which scales pixel art perfectly to modern portable resolutions without the "wobbly" artifacts of CRT filters or the blurriness of bilinear filters.
